The systematic analysis of an annual report of a large Canadian public company provides a framework and a set of skills and concepts to determine whether it is worth investing in the company. The detailed examination of the annual report includes an analysis of profitability — including return on capital employed, return on equity, return on sales, gross profit margin and asset turnover — and liquidity measures.
